Greece

At the beginning of the 21st century, a law was passed in the country that prohibited gambling in Internet cafes. Literally a year later, the legislation was tightened and even regular video games were banned in the state. As a result, residents could not play on consoles like Sony Playstation, or even chess online.

USA

The most developed country in the world is famous for its truly idiotic laws that are in force in some states. In the area of gambling-related legislation, there are truly absurd laws here.

In Oklahoma, card sharps are punished especially severely if they operate in train stations or train plazas. They are also prohibited in other public places, but the punishment is not as severe.

In the state of Washington, playing online casinos was equated to a very serious crime. And this was done quite recently, in 2006. According to the law, citizens do not have the right not only to play, but even to transmit personal information via the Internet to register in gambling establishments. Oddly enough, for 15 years, the authorities have not recorded a single case of violations.

If you don't want to go to jail for a few months for a simple bet with a friend, don't make any bets in public places in Ohio. You can't bet in restaurants, cafes, stores, etc. As for slot machines, they are banned here, as in most other states. However, local legislators went further than their colleagues and added an amendment to the law banning "one-armed bandits" specifying that the machines cannot be installed in public places, including toilets.

Arizona has passed a law that prohibits the involvement of indigenous people (Indians) in gambling. In case of violation of this law, you can get a solid sentence. And in New Jersey, the so-called "responsible game" is very developed. Gamblers can independently block their access to any online games for a period of one to five years. In case of violation of the established restrictions, they will have to pay a hefty fine to the state treasury.
